Fall for what marketing? It's a solution that NOBODY else offers right now. A truck that can be used in full EV mode for 90% of day to day driving, but still allows you to travel or pull a trailer as far as you want without the range anxiety of an EV. Just stop and get gas...then go 5 minutes later. For larger SUVs and Trucks, hybrids are the best solution we have to drastically reduce emissions in these types of vehicles, without the "baggage" of owning an large EV SUV or truck.

Decided I didn't want to continue beating me and my new car up, bit the bullet and replaced the run flats (at 7500 miles). My only regret is not doing it sooner. The car is softer, better isolated (a massively amount better isolated) with no loss in handling. I used to come home from a day out having fun beat up and tired. Not anymore. YMMV |
